How Our Office Building Water Extraction Service Works
When water damage occurs in an office building, it’s essential to act fast. Our team follows a structured process to ensure that every step is taken to reduce damage and restore your property. We start by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the leak or flood, and developing a customized plan to extract the water and dry the affected area.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team arrives on-site to assess the damage and identify the source of the water. We take photos and videos to document the damage for insurance purposes. Our technicians then develop a plan to extract the water and dry the affected area, using advanced equipment to ensure efficient and effective results.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our team extracts the water from the affected area. We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water, and then dry the area using specialized equipment to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team uses specialized equipment to dry the affected area, including dehumidifiers and air movers. We also use thermal imaging to detect any hidden moisture, ensuring that your property is completely d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
Once the area is dry, our team cleans and disinfects the affected area, removing any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ated during the water damage.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Finally, our team makes any necessary repairs to your property, including replacing damaged materials and restoring your office building to its original condition.

Warning Signs You Need Office Building Water Extraction
Water damage can be sneaky, but there are warning signs to look out for. Ignoring these signs can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Here are some common warning signs that show you need office building water extraction: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your office building can be a sign of water damage. If you notice a musty smell that persists even after cleaning, it’s time to call us.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ains on walls and 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any discoloration or warping of surfaces,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.
Warped or Buckled Floors
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any uneven or sagging floors, it’s time to call us for help.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any peeling or bubbling on walls or ceilings,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.
Discolored or Fuzzy Carpeting
Discolored or fuzzy carpeting can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any discoloration or fuzziness on carpeting, it’s time to call us for help.

Office Building Water Extraction Cost in Lomita, CA
The cost of office building water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lomita, CA. Here are some estimated price ranges for different services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Cleaning and Disinfection |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ials used |
| Restoration and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ials used |
| Insurance Help | $100 – $500 | Complexity of claim, type of insurance coverage |
Keep in mind that these are estimated price ranges, and the actual cost of office building water extraction will depend on the specifics of your situation. We offer free on-site assessments to find out the exact cost of our services.
